Comilla Speed Crash Glossary

New to crash games? These are the terms that come up most often when you are learning how Comilla Speed Crash rounds work.

What is the multiplier in Comilla Speed Crash?

The multiplier is the number that climbs from 1.01× at round start. Your payout equals your stake times whatever value you cash out at before the line crashes.

What does cash-out mean in a crash game?

Cash-out is the action that locks in your current multiplier and moves the payout to your account balance. If you do not cash out before the crash, the round stake is lost.

What is a provably fair seed in Comilla Speed Crash?

A provably fair seed is a cryptographic hash generated before betting opens. It fixes the crash point in advance so neither the platform nor you can change the result mid-round.

What does auto cash-out mean?

Auto cash-out is a preset multiplier target you enter before the round starts. The system cashes out automatically when the multiplier reaches that level, removing the need for manual timing.

What is the house edge in crash games?

House edge is the built-in margin the platform retains over many rounds. In Comilla Speed Crash, the RTP figure is shown in the game panel where the provider exposes it — we do not publish invented percentages.

What is a round ID in Comilla Speed Crash?

A round ID is a unique identifier assigned to each Comilla Speed Crash round. You can use it when contacting support to locate the exact result and payout record for that session.
